Surrounded by tropical gardens, this elegant spa hotel is located on the seashore 3.1 mi outside Kato Paphos. It is ideal for a relaxing and rejuvenating break on sunny Cyprus. It features 2 large separate grounds for families and adults over 16 years old. Free WiFi is provided throughout. Soak up the warm sunshine on a sun lounger before diving into the Azia Resort & Spa's 2 outdoor pools. You can also find relaxation with one of the indulgent spa treatments and in the indoor pool, sauna or hot tub and join activities like yoga and water polo. Stylish decor ranges from bright and contemporary to exotic, Arabian-inspired touches. Lounges are found by the poolside, along with several great drinking and dining venues.

Tripplo's Expert Review
Azia Resort & Spa occupies a coastal position in Paphos, defined by its lush gardens and distinct zones for adults and families. The property balances relaxation and activity with its comprehensive spa facilities and Arabian-inspired aesthetic. It is well-suited for travelers seeking a structured resort experience outside the main urban center.
What Guests Loved
The resort maintains two separate grounds for adults and families, ensuring those seeking tranquility and those traveling with children enjoy designated environments. This layout effectively minimizes noise disruption for couples and solo travelers.
Moving away from standard Mediterranean minimalism, the decor incorporates exotic textures and Arabian-inspired elements. These touches provide a sophisticated visual character that distinguishes the property from more conventional coastal hotels in Cyprus.
Things to Consider
Situated five kilometers from Kato Paphos harbor, guests require a vehicle or public transport to access the main archaeological sites. However, the resort's secluded position offers a quieter environment away from the city center bustle.
The design aesthetic varies between contemporary updates and more traditional wings. While some visitors appreciate the historical character, others might find the stylistic transition between different areas of the hotel to be somewhat inconsistent.
